HDK
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
RE_TextureCubeMap Member List

This is the complete list of members for RE_TextureCubeMap, including all inherited members.

allowPreload(bool preload)RE_TextureMapinline
allowsPreload() const RE_TextureMapinline
backgroundTextureLoadThreads(int n)RE_TextureMapstatic
buildSourceName(UT_String &cachedname, const char *map, const char *rel)RE_TextureMapprotectedvirtual
bumpVersion()RE_TextureMap
cachedTextureFound(RE_Texture *tex)RE_TextureMapinlineprotectedvirtual
callModifyCallback(RE_Texture *tex, void *data)RE_TextureMapprotected
checkAlphaDetails(bool check)RE_TextureMapinline
className() const RE_TextureMapinlinevirtual
clear(const char *clear_name=nullptr)RE_TextureMap
clearStoredTexture()RE_TextureMap
clearTextureCache(bool full_clear)RE_TextureMapstatic
clone() const overrideRE_TextureCubeMapvirtual
copy(const RE_TextureMap *src)RE_TextureMapprotected
debugDumpCache()RE_TextureMapstatic
deleteTexRef(RE_Texture *tex)RE_TextureMap
fetchTexture(RE_Render *r, bool build_if_missing, bool preload_only)RE_TextureMapprotected
fillRGBFromSingle(bool fill_rgb_mono)RE_TextureMapinline
filter()RE_TextureMapinline
filter() const RE_TextureMapinline
get2DTextureFP16Size()RE_TextureMapstatic
get2DTextureFP32Size()RE_TextureMapstatic
get2DTextureUsage()RE_TextureMapstatic
get3DTextureFP16Size()RE_TextureMapstatic
get3DTextureFP32Size()RE_TextureMapstatic
get3DTextureUsage()RE_TextureMapstatic
getAlphaDetails() const RE_TextureMapinline
getAspectRatio()RE_TextureMap
getAspectRatioXZ()RE_TextureMap
getCachedTexture(RE_Render *r)RE_TextureMap
getColorSpace() const RE_TextureMap
getCompression() const RE_TextureMapinlineprotected
getDesiredResolution(RE_GPUType type, int vsize, int *w, int *h, int *d)RE_TextureMapprotected
getFormatSize()RE_TextureMap
getFormatType()RE_TextureMap
getMapName() const RE_TextureMapinline
getMapType() overrideRE_TextureCubeMapinlinevirtual
getMemoryUsage(bool inclusive) const overrideRE_TextureCubeMapvirtual
getMipMap() const RE_TextureMapinlineprotected
getMipMapUsage()RE_TextureMapstatic
getNumUsedTextureMaps()RE_TextureMapstatic
getOpaqueAlpha() const RE_TextureMapinline
getOrig2DTextureFP16Size()RE_TextureMapstatic
getOrig2DTextureFP32Size()RE_TextureMapstatic
getOrig3DTextureFP16Size()RE_TextureMapstatic
getOrig3DTextureFP32Size()RE_TextureMapstatic
getRelativePath() const RE_TextureMapinline
getResolution(int &w, int &h, int &d)RE_TextureMap
getSourceOpID() const RE_TextureMapinlinevirtual
getTexture(RE_Render *r, bool deferred_load=false)RE_TextureMap
getTextureCacheSerial()RE_TextureMapstatic
getTextureCacheSize()RE_TextureMapstatic
getTextureCacheUsage()RE_TextureMapstatic
getTextureFormatOption() const RE_TextureMapinlineprotected
getTextureSource(const char *map, const char *relto, void **tex_data, bool deferred_load=false, bool preload_only=false)RE_TextureMapprotected
getTextureStub(bool preload)RE_TextureMapprotected
getUncachedTexture(RE_Render *r)RE_TextureMap
getUsedTextureMemory()RE_TextureMapstatic
getVersion() const RE_TextureMapinline
hasTaggedTexture() const RE_TextureMapinline
hasValidSourceResolve() const RE_TextureMapinline
invalidateCached()RE_TextureMapvirtual
isLoadPending() const RE_TextureMapinline
isNodeSource()RE_TextureMapprotected
isSourceValid()RE_TextureMap
makePow2(bool pow2)RE_TextureMap
maxMemSize(int mem_limit_mb)RE_TextureMap
maxSize(int w, int h, int d)RE_TextureMap
myAlphaDetailsRE_TextureMapprotected
myAlphaInfoRE_TextureMapprotected
myCompressionRE_TextureMapprotected
myFileCloseRE_TextureMapprotected
myFileOpenRE_TextureMapprotected
myMakePow2RE_TextureMapprotected
myMapNameRE_TextureMapprotected
myMaxMemMBRE_TextureMapprotected
myMaxResRE_TextureMapprotected
myMipMapRE_TextureMapprotected
myResRE_TextureMapprotected
myScaleRE_TextureMapprotected
newTextureMap(RE_TextureDimension type)RE_TextureMapstatic
pruneTextureCache()RE_TextureMapstatic
RE_TextureCubeMap()RE_TextureCubeMap
RE_TextureMap()RE_TextureMapprotected
recordingTextureUsage()RE_TextureMapstatic
recordTextureMapUsage(bool enable)RE_TextureMapstatic
reset()RE_TextureMap
scaleTo(fpreal w, fpreal h=-1.0f, fpreal d=-1.0f)RE_TextureMap
setColorSpace(PXL_ColorSpace space)RE_TextureMap
setCompression(RE_TextureCompress comp)RE_TextureMap
setMipMap(bool mip)RE_TextureMap
setNamespace(const char *ns)RE_TextureMapinline
setOpaqueAlpha(bool opaque_alpha)RE_TextureMapinline
setPendingLoad(bool pend)RE_TextureMapinlineprotected
setSource(const char *mapname, const char *relativeTo)RE_TextureMap
setSource(const char *mapname, UT_Functor2< IMG_File *, const char *, const IMG_FileParms & > file_open, UT_Functor1< void, IMG_File * > file_close)RE_TextureMap
setSource(const char *mapname, const char *relativeTo, RE_Texture *texture, RE_CacheVersion version, bool(*releaseCB)(RE_Texture *, void *), void *releaseObject)RE_TextureMap
setSourceModifyCallback(const char *opname, bool(*modifyCallback)(RE_TextureMap *map, TexCBPixelData &pixdata, void *user_data), void *user_data)RE_TextureMap
setTextureCacheSize(int64 size_in_mb)RE_TextureMapstatic
setTextureComponent(int texcomp)RE_TextureMapinline
setTextureFormatOption(RE_TextureFormatExtra opt)RE_TextureMapinline
setupGammaCorrect(IMG_FileParms &parms, const char *filename, RE_GPUType datatype)RE_TextureMapprotected
setValidSourceResolve(bool valid)RE_TextureMap
setVersion(RE_CacheVersion v)RE_TextureMapinline
sizeTo(int w, int h, int d=1)RE_TextureMap
textureDeleted(RE_Texture *tex)RE_TextureMapstatic
textureReferenceDeleted(void *, RE_Texture *t)RE_TextureMapstatic
textureUsed(RE_Texture *tex)RE_TextureMapstatic
~RE_TextureCubeMap() overrideRE_TextureCubeMap
~RE_TextureMap()RE_TextureMapvirtual